Summary

Importance of the Topic


Analysis of benzotriazole in insulating oil is crucial for ensuring the long term reliability of electrical equipment. Benzotriazole functions as a corrosion inhibitor in metal parts and its concentration affects both performance and chemical stability of insulating fluids.

Objective and Study Overview


This application note describes a rapid and robust HPLC method for determining 1,2,3-benzotriazole in transformer oil. The focus is on simple sample preparation and reliable quantification using reversed phase chromatography.

Methodology and Instrumentation


  • Instrument system Prominence-i
  • Column Shim-pack VP-ODS 150 mm L × 4.6 mm I D, 5 μm
  • Mobile phase water / methanol ratio 6 / 4 by volume
  • Flow rate 1.0 mL per minute
  • Column temperature 40 degree C
  • Injection volume 5 μL
  • Detection UV at 270 nm

Sample pretreatment involves dilution of insulating oil with the mobile phase mixture followed by filtration to remove particulates prior to injection.

Main Results and Discussion


The method provides a clear peak for benzotriazole with baseline separation from major oil matrix components. Calibration over a typical working range yields excellent linearity and reproducibility. UV detection at 270 nm offers sufficient sensitivity for routine analysis in quality control laboratories.

Benefits and Practical Applications


  • Minimal sample preparation without laborious extraction steps
  • Short analysis time compatible with high throughput demands
  • Reliable quantification for transformer maintenance and oil condition monitoring
  • Applicable to preventive diagnostics and regulatory compliance

Future Trends and Potential Applications


Integration of this method with automated sample handling and coupling with mass spectrometry could further improve sensitivity and specificity. Emerging green solvents and microflow techniques may reduce solvent consumption and enhance method sustainability.

Conclusion


The described HPLC protocol enables fast and accurate determination of benzotriazole in insulating oil. Its simplicity and robustness make it suitable for routine quality assurance and equipment life cycle management.
